Sir, Yes, Sir! is a mission in Grand Theft Auto: Vice City given to protagonist Tommy Vercetti by retired army colonel Juan Cortez from his boat docked in Washington Beach, Vice City.
Mission
Cortez has a buyer who wants a tank, which is being taken with a military convoy to Fort Baxter Air Base and he wants Tommy to steal it and drive it to a lock-up in Little Haiti. Tommy drives to the convoy and steals the tank (which stops at a doughnut shop in Little Havana) and drives it to the lock-up before the tank self destructs.
Script
Juan Cortez: Diaz was pleased, and would like to meet you again.
Tommy Vercetti: Is that a good thing?
Juan Cortez: Of course! Although I'm starting to think that Diaz was responsible for our unfortunate loss...
Tommy Vercetti: What makes you say that?
Juan Cortez: One does not wave accusations at a man like Diaz - I'm merely thinking out loud...No matter. I have a proposal that you could profit from...
Tommy Vercetti: I don't have time to run more errands, Cortez.
Juan Cortez: I would have thought a man with such dangerous debts would be hungry for opportunities. Please, Tommy. At least hear me out.
Tommy Vercetti: Go on...
Juan Cortez: I have a buyer for a piece of military hardware being taken across town. Go pick it up for me...Once you get it, I want you to call me immediately. Then...
(Tommy drives to the convoy and steals the tank)
Military Operator: Security protocol. Delta India Echo triggered. Vehicle self-destruct initiated.
Reward
The reward for completing the mission is $2,000.
